Step 1: Assessment and Planning
Quick and thorough assessment of the damage to find out the best course of action. Our team will identify the source of the water, the extent of the damage, and develop a plan to extract the water and dry your cabinets. This step typically takes 30 minutes to 1 hour.
Step 2: Water Extraction
Efficient water extraction using specialized equipment to remove water from your cabinets and surrounding areas. This step typically takes 1-2 hours depending on the severity of the damage.
Step 3: Drying and Dehumidification
Thorough drying and dehumidification to prevent mold growth and structural damage. Our team will use specialized equipment to remove excess moisture from your cabinets and surrounding areas. This step typically takes 2-5 days depending on the severity of the damage.
Step 4: Disinfection and Sanitization
Disinfection and sanitization to ensure your home is safe and healthy. Our team will use specialized equipment and techniques to remove any remaining bacteria, viruses, or other microorganisms that may be present in your cabinets and surrounding areas.
Step 5: Final Inspection and Cleaning
Final inspection and cleaning to ensure your home is safe and healthy. Our team will inspect your cabinets and surrounding areas to ensure they are completely dry and free of any remaining moisture or damage.

Under-Cabinet Water Extraction Cost in Ramah, CO
The cost of Under-Cabinet Water Extraction services in Ramah, CO, varies based on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ions. Our team will provide a free estimate after assessing the damage and developing a plan to extract the water and dry your cabinets.
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Initial Assessment and Planning | $100 - $500 | Severity of damage, size of affected area |
| Water Extraction and Drying | $500 - $2,500 | Severity of damage, size of affected area, equipment needed |
| Disinfection and Sanitization | $200 - $1,000 | Severity of damage, size of affected area |
| Final Inspection and Cleaning | $100 - $500 | Severity of damage, size of affected area |
| More Equipment or Labor | $500 - $2,500 | Severity of damage, size of affected area, equipment needed |
| Free Estimate and Consultation | $0 | Free consultation and estimate |
